| // Bicubic filter kernel function. |
| static float Bicubic(float x) { |
| const float a = -0.5; |
| x = std::abs(x); |
| float x2 = x * x; |
| float x3 = x2 * x; |
| if (x <= 1) { |
| return (a + 2) * x3 - (a + 3) * x2 + 1; |
| } else if (x < 2) { |
| return a * x3 - 5 * a * x2 + 8 * a * x - 4 * a; |
| } else { |
| return 0.0f; |
| } |
| } |

| // Works like a GL_LINEAR lookup on an SkBitmap. |
| float Bilinear(SkBitmap* pixels, float x, float y, int c) { |
| x -= 0.5; |
| y -= 0.5; |
| int base_x = static_cast<int>(floorf(x)); |
| int base_y = static_cast<int>(floorf(y)); |
| x -= base_x; |
| y -= base_y; |
| return (ChannelAsFloat(pixels, base_x, base_y, c) * (1 - x) * (1 - y) + |
| ChannelAsFloat(pixels, base_x + 1, base_y, c) * x * (1 - y) + |
| ChannelAsFloat(pixels, base_x, base_y + 1, c) * (1 - x) * y + |
| ChannelAsFloat(pixels, base_x + 1, base_y + 1, c) * x * y); |
| } |

| // Encodes an RGBA bitmap to grayscale. |
| // Reference implementation for |
| // GLHelper::CopyToTextureImpl::EncodeTextureAsGrayscale. |
| void EncodeToGrayscaleSlow(SkBitmap* input, SkBitmap* output) { |
| const float kRGBtoGrayscaleColorWeights[3] = {0.213f, 0.715f, 0.072f}; |
| CHECK_EQ(kAlpha_8_SkColorType, output->colorType()); |
| CHECK_EQ(input->width(), output->width()); |
| CHECK_EQ(input->height(), output->height()); |
| CHECK_EQ(input->colorType(), kRGBA_8888_SkColorType); |
| |
| for (int dst_y = 0; dst_y < output->height(); dst_y++) { |
| for (int dst_x = 0; dst_x < output->width(); dst_x++) { |
| float c0 = ChannelAsFloat(input, dst_x, dst_y, 0); |
| float c1 = ChannelAsFloat(input, dst_x, dst_y, 1); |
| float c2 = ChannelAsFloat(input, dst_x, dst_y, 2); |
| float value = c0 * kRGBtoGrayscaleColorWeights[0] + |
| c1 * kRGBtoGrayscaleColorWeights[1] + |
| c2 * kRGBtoGrayscaleColorWeights[2]; |
| SetChannel(output, dst_x, dst_y, 0, |
| static_cast<int>(value * 255.0f + 0.5f)); |
| } |
| } |
| } |
